JUST IN: Amazon says it will stop police from using its facial recognition technology for a year while the company waits for federal regulation of the surveillance tool.
Liz O’Sullivan, a privacy activist and founder or Arthur AI, described the announcement as a “victory for activists and academics” who have been pushing for stricter regulation of facial recognition for years. But she noted that it was an “admission that the entire system of surveillance is flawed, biased and has racial implications.”
The one-year moratorium on police use of Amazon Rekognition does not include organizations that work closely with law enforcement to identify victims of child sexual exploitation and human trafficking, such as nonprofit Thorn, the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children and Marinus Analytics.
